    Don't know if you'll accept or if any will agree , but you asked.....

    I view a 9 hole round as a sprint and a full round as a marathon. Some will handle trouble better than others , but I believe whether here at WGT or on the real course , somewhere along that 18 hole marathon WE WILL BE TESTED.  It's golf. It's the karma of golf. It is a rhythm. A rhythm that is very similar to a "pre-shot routine". If that routine is broken in anyway. Step away , clear the head and start routine over. O.K. It sounds like you were in a rhythm. I can almost bet that between the 9'th and 10'th something occurred. You may have went to the bathroom , kitchen , phone rang , knock at the door , but something broke your rhythm , and you didn't "Step away" and you didn't "clear the head." Just like someone who's pre-shot routine was broken , but decided to go through with an uncomfortable shot...99.9% of the time they'll be rewarded with uncomfortable results. Hope that made sense to ya' Ren. To hold an 18 hole round together you can't bring a mistake made on # 10 to the 11'th tee with you. Because you'll make 2 more at 11. Then your bringing 10 and 11 to the 12'th....and the domino disaster has begun.   It's GOLF.  It's just golf.  The answer is  focus.  Determined focus.  Course management.  Minimize mistakes. Refuse to be rattled.
